ARBITRARY
(adj.) based on or subject to individual discretion or preference or sometimes impulse or caprice
"an arbitrary decision", "the arbitrary rule of a dictator", "an arbitrary penalty", "of arbitrary size and shape", "an arbitrary choice", "arbitrary division of the group into halves"
The arbitrary decision of the office management to sack a few employees angered everybody. -added by naila_inlas
